COVER: ANYA SETON, Author of "The Winthrop Woman."
SR/IDEAS:
New Worlds in Education, by
John K. Weiss, Sumner C.
Powell, Ann Beckner, and
Paul A. Schilpp.
Ideas: "Man Is Not Primarily a
Fact," by Dr. Glenn Olds.
SR/BOOKS -- REVIEWS:
The Winthrop Woman, by Anya
Seton ...
Reviewed by Edmund Fuller.
About the Author: ANYA SETON.
The Return of Ansel Gibbs, by
Frederick Buechner ...
Reviewed by A. C. Spectorsky.
The Confession, by Mario Soldati
Reviewed by Thomas G. Bergin ...
A Time to Be Happy, by Nayantara Sahgal ...
Reviewed by John Masters.
The Titans, by Andre Maurois ...
Reviewed by Henri Peyre.
Naked to Mine Enemies, by
Charles W. Ferguson ...
Reviewed by Garrett Mattingly.
The French Nation: From Napoleon to Petain 1840-1940,
by D. W. Brogan ...
Reviewed by Leo Gershoy.
Sparks Off My Anvil: From Thirty
Years in Advertising, by James
R. Adams ...
Reviewed by J. R. Cominsky.
Adenauer and the New Germany:
The Chancellor oF the Vanquished, by Edgar Alexander ...
Reviewed by Quincy Howe.
The Time of the Panther, by Wesley Ford Davis ...
Reviewed by Pat Frank.
David Livingstone: His Life and
Letters, by George Seaver ...
Reviewed by Geoffrey Bruun.
SR/DEPARTMENTS: Trade Winds. Letters to the Editor. Broadway Postscript. TV and Radio. SR Goes to the Movies. Literary Crypt. Music to My Ears. Booked for Travel. Literary I.Q. Books for Young People. Kingsley Double-Crostic No. 1247.
